It's important you set aside a journal. I suggest an A5 notebook which is just the right size so you can take it to work, on trips, to the beach, wherever. It's so accessible and if you have a bright spark during your day you will add it to your list. Make it is your own style, your own aesthetic, colour scheme because this is YOUR place to ensure your dreams are achieved. With an appealing design scheme it will become your sacred place.

1. Time Division

Divide your sections into a time scale. Monthly is advised as it's not too short term and not too long term.

2. Layout

Under the monthly section you are going to set yourself 5 GOALS. 1 GOAL for each page.

3. Goal List

For each GOAL you are going to state it clearly with today's date. 'GOAL #1: GET FIT. 25/12/2017.'

4. Actions

'ACTIONS TO HELP ME COMPLETE THIS GOAL.' Once you have written your GOAL, bullet point all the things you are going to do this month to achieve it.

  1. Stick to my healthy meal plan and don't give in.
  2. Go to the gym at least 4 evenings a week.
  3. Cut out my restricted foods that will not help my progress.

5. Inspiration

'INSPIRATION FOR ACHIEVING MY GOAL.' Identify your inspirations for this goal. This can be in writing, by pictures, drawings, a quote—get creative.

6. Goal Achieving

'HOW WILL I FEEL WHEN I HAVE ACHIEVED THIS GOAL.' What would it mean to you? What are all the positive things that will occur once this exciting thing has been achieved? "I will feel so confident in Cannes this year in my bikini."

7. Potential Reward and Date Completed

Save space for the date to be noted down when you can finally say I DID IT! With this comes a potential reward if it is completed. "I will treat myself to a double cheese burger extra large fries and full fat cola."

8. Values

'MY TOP 5 CORE VALUES.' Alongside your GOAL page you can reiterate your core values. List them down and watch as self realisation takes place. "I am energetic and confident that I will get fit." Use this as a place to note down mantras that will motivate you if you are feeling uninspired.

9. Thoughts & Feelings

Set aside a page at the end of each month for the reflection.

10. Old Habits & New Habits

Get stuck in and be honest about old habits and be proud of your new habits that have risen.

11. Rewards

You’ve completed your GOALS. So now reap all the rewards that comes with it. Write them down include memories or photos. BE PROUD.

When you look back on your GOALS journal throughout the year you'll be amazed at what you achieved and all the benefits that were rightfully earned during the process. This journal is about keeping your thoughts in check and making sure that you are on track, always. With anything, I believe writing something down enables it to become more of a reality. Failure will not be an option when you organise your determination so that every day you do something that will inch you towards a better tomorrow.
